Composite Number

61075

61075 is a odd composite number that follows 61074 and precedes 61076. It is composed of 12 distinct factors: 1, 5, 7, 25, 35, 175, 349, 1745, 2443, 8725, 12215, 61075. Its prime factorization can be written as 5^2 × 7 × 349. 61075 is classified as a deficient number based on the sum of its proper divisors. In computer science, 61075 is represented as 1110111010010011 in binary and EE93 in hexadecimal. It also belongs to the triangular number sequence.
